Transaction 341958bf6345c54858e4e0aff5a613a877d1d86d46eb785605ea39b9093e83fc

2 Input
2 Outputs
  • 341958bf6345c54858e4e0aff5a613a877d1d86d46eb785605ea39b9093e83fc:0
  • value  345000000
    address  1Q7jbscjf2nxL4HnFxvZsXCLHCx8JqheQa
  • 341958bf6345c54858e4e0aff5a613a877d1d86d46eb785605ea39b9093e83fc:1
  • value  1020894
    address  1ALhm9pvneXYzQ8gmhoohrjP253g3CPH3z